Ethics and practical reason

Author: Garrett Cullity; Berys Nigel Gaut
Publisher: Oxford : Clarendon Press ; New York : Oxford University Press, 1997.

Notes: "The majority of essays in this volume were presented in earlier versions at the Ethics and Practical Reason Conference held by the Department of Moral Philosophy at the University of St. Andrews from 23 to 26 March 1995"--Acknowledgements.
Description: viii, 421 p. : ill. ; 25 cm.
Contents: Deciding how to decide / J. David Velleman --
On the hypothetical and non-hypothetical in reasoning about belief and action / Peter Railton --
Humean doubts about the practical justification of morality / James Dreier --
Practical theory / Garrett Cullity --
Moral judgement and reasons for action / Robert Audi --
The structure of practical resaon / Berys Gaut --
Practical reason divided : Aquinas and his critics / T.H. Irwin --
The normativity of instrumental reason / Christine M. Korsgaard --
Kantian rationalism : inescapability, authority, and supremacy / David O. Brink --
A theory of freedom and responsibility / Michael Smith --
Reason and responsibility / R. Jay Wallace --
Reasons and reason / John Skorupski --
The amoralist / Joseph Raz.
